1. Refresh Your Space with a Modern Color Palette

One of the simplest yet most powerful ways to elevate your kitchen décor is to update your color palette. The colors you choose set the mood for the entire space.
Popular Trending Shades
- Earthy neutrals like warm beige, taupe, and stone gray for a calming atmosphere.
- Soft greens inspired by nature to bring in a peaceful, organic vibe.
- Navy blue or midnight blue, which adds sophistication and works beautifully with gold or brushed brass accents.
- All-white palettes, perfect for opening up smaller kitchens and achieving a clean, timeless look.
How to Apply Color Creatively
- Paint your cabinets for an instant facelift.
- Add color through bar stools, kitchen rugs, or decorative bowls.
- Choose a two-tone cabinet design dark on the bottom, light on top.
Updating your color palette sets the foundation for all other décor choices, ensuring cohesion and style.
2. Add Warmth and Texture with Natural Wood Elements

Natural wood is a timeless décor element that instantly elevates any kitchen. It brings warmth, organic texture, and a welcoming feel.
Ways to Incorporate Wood
- Use wooden open shelves for displaying dinnerware and cookbooks.
- Add cutting boards, wooden serving trays, or bamboo utensils.
- Install wood beam accents or a wood-paneled island.
- Choose oak or walnut cabinet doors for a luxurious touch.
Why It Works
Wood pairs effortlessly with virtually any aesthetic modern, rustic, farmhouse, Scandinavian, or industrial. It also softens the coldness of stone countertops and metal appliances, creating balance throughout the space.
3. Elevate Your Kitchen with Statement Lighting

Lighting is one of the most impactful kitchen décor changes you can make. It does more than brighten your space it defines the atmosphere.
Types of Lighting That Make an Impact
- Pendant lights over the island make for a stunning visual centerpiece.
- Under-cabinet LED strips illuminate countertops while enhancing mood.
- Chandeliers or sculptural fixtures add elegance and creativity.
- Recessed ceiling lights keep things neat and modern.
Design Tips
Use lighting as both a functional and decorative element. Choose fixtures that align with your style sleek metallics for modern kitchens, rattan or woven pendants for boho or coastal spaces, or glass globes for a minimalist look.
4. Bring Style and Function Together with Open Shelving

Open shelving has become a major trend, and for good reason. It offers aesthetic appeal and functional convenience.
Why Choose Open Shelving?
- It creates an airy, spacious look.
- You can display your favorite dishware, vases, and cookbooks.
- Items you use daily stay within easy reach.
Styling Tips
- Mix decorative items with practical cookware.
- Use matching dishes for a cohesive appearance.
- Incorporate small plants or herbs for a fresh, lively feel.
Open shelves make your kitchen feel personal and inviting, turning everyday objects into décor pieces.
5. Choose a Bold Backsplash to Make a Statement

A backsplash is the perfect place to showcase your creativity. It’s functional, protects the walls, and serves as a visual anchor in the kitchen.
Trending Backsplash Ideas
- Subway tiles for classic charm with a modern touch.
- Moroccan or geometric patterned tiles for artistic flair.
- Herringbone or chevron layouts to add dimension.
- Full slab marble or quartz for luxury and seamless elegance.
Color and Material Considerations
Choose colors that complement your cabinets and countertop. If your kitchen is neutral, a bold backsplash can create character and contrast.
6. Create a Functional Focal Point with a Kitchen Island

A kitchen island adds storage, seating, and style all at once. It often becomes the center of family activity and entertaining.
Reasons to Add an Island
- More prep space
- Extra storage with cabinets or drawers
- Additional seating for guests or family
- Opportunity for statement lighting
Design Ideas
- Add a waterfall countertop for a modern, dramatic look.
- Choose a contrasting color for the island base to make it stand out.
- Install built-in shelves for cookbooks or display items.
A well-designed island becomes one of the most practical and beautiful features in any kitchen.
7. Bring Life into Your Kitchen with Indoor Plants

Plants instantly add freshness, color, and natural energy to your kitchen décor.
Best Plant Choices for Kitchens
- Small potted herbs like basil, mint, and rosemary.
- Snake plants for low-maintenance greenery.
- Hanging plants like pothos or ivy.
- Countertop succulents for a touch of charm.
Creative Ways to Display Plants
- Place them on window sills for added sunlight.
- Use wall-mounted planters to save counter space.
- Incorporate them into open shelving for a layered look.
Plants improve air quality and contribute to a calming atmosphere perfect for a room where you spend so much time.
8. Update Your Hardware for an Instant Mini-Makeover

Sometimes the smallest details make the biggest difference. Updating cabinet handles, drawer pulls, and faucets can instantly modernize your kitchen.
Popular Hardware Finishes
- Brushed brass for a warm, luxurious feel.
- Matte black for contemporary elegance.
- Chrome or stainless steel for a sleek, clean look.
- Antique bronze for rustic or farmhouse décor.
Design Tip
Choose hardware that complements your appliances and lighting fixtures. Consistency creates a polished, cohesive design.
9. Accessorize Thoughtfully for a Personalized Touch

Accessories are essential to tying your kitchen décor together. They allow you to bring in pops of color, pattern, and personality.
Decor Items to Consider
- Decorative jars filled with dried goods or colorful spices.
- Ceramic vases, fruit bowls, and trays.
- Stylish cutting boards or woven baskets.
- Patterned rugs or runners for warmth and comfort.
Keep It Balanced
Be intentional avoid clutter by choosing fewer items with more impact. The right accessories can transform your kitchen without overwhelming it.
10. Make Your Kitchen More Memorable with Unique Wall Art

Art isn’t just for living rooms or bedrooms your kitchen walls can also benefit from creative expression.
Types of Art That Work Well in Kitchens
- Vintage posters or food-themed prints.
- Framed botanical illustrations.
- Minimalist line drawings.
- Chalkboard walls for writing recipes or notes.
- Metal wall sculptures for a modern twist.
Placement Ideas
- Above the breakfast nook
- Next to open shelves
- On an empty wall near windows
- Over the pantry door
Wall art adds charm, character, and emotion making your kitchen feel more like a curated space.
